// Image cache leak notes (Quellhaven thumbnail pipeline):
// Decoded bitmaps were pinned by a strong-ref callback registry that
// was never pruned after eviction, so resident memory grew unbounded
// under sustained crawl traffic. Security-relevant angle: an attacker
// uploading many large images could exhaust the host and degrade the
// sandbox isolation checks that share this process. Fix: weak refs plus
// a periodic sweep, bounded by byte budget rather than entry count.
// The sweep cadence and budget are governed by the constants below.

limits module of fajog-tawig:
RATE_LIMITS = {
    "druwyn": 2,
    "quenael": 10,
    "wenix": 2,
    "druael": 2,
}

## Artifact Signing: DeployBot Status Announcer

For the weekly sync: the DeployBot chat announcer now only reports builds that pass signature verification. Unsigned or mismatched artifacts are flagged in the channel with a warning instead of a green check. This closed the gap where Murkwell staging builds were announced as healthy despite failing verification. Bot releases themselves are also signed now, so updates to DeployBot follow the same pipeline as everything else. All verification runs against the release key listed below.

deploy key for kajof-fajop: bky6_gDHw9Q

## Configuration

Chiptrack Relay ingests RFID reads from mat antennas at Osterfield Marathon checkpoints. All reader traffic is TLS 1.3 only. Set `READER_ALLOWLIST` to the antenna subnet and `DEDUP_WINDOW_MS=800`. Reads are signed before upload to the results service; replay protection depends on clock sync via `NTP_HOST`. The upload signer requires its HMAC secret on the next line of the env file.

sealed setting: ARCHIVE_KEY3=8d0